The mother and father of a 9-month-old are facing charges after the baby overdosed on heroin that they reportedly left all over their home. 

Last Monday, a mother was changing her infant’s diaper when she noticed the child was lethargic and pale. She called the authorities for emergency assistance. 

When the first responders arrived at the house, they reported that the child was not breathing. They believed the youngster had overdosed on opioids, and they administered a dose of Narcan.

A group of people in Portland are facing charges after the police learned they were allegedly operating a business called Shroom House where they sold magic mushrooms. 

According to reports, a store in Portland, Oregon called Shroom House opened its doors to the public on October 24. The shop reportedly sold magic mushrooms to the public. 

When the authorities learned about the establishment, they reportedly had two undercover agents visit and purchase just over an ounce of mushrooms. The fungi allegedly tested positive for psilocybin.
